Overview
Leeford Cottage is nearly 500 years old with all that you would expect from such an aged house - beams, inglenooks, log fires, very prettily decorated rooms and superb views from all sides. Brendon, the village, is tucked away in a hidden valley nestling between the glorious North Devon coast, and Exmoor, famed for it's wild ponies and red deer. It's a haven of peace and tranquillity. In one direction you'll find the historic Doone valley and in another Watersmeet with it's cascading waterfalls.
All rooms have their own private facilities. Each room is very pretty, sporting hand-made patchwork quilts and hand-painted furniture. A guest's lounge with T.V. and a working 30's radio is available. The lounge features a host of beams and an inglenook fireplace with log fire. The cottage is kept spotless and all the rooms are thoroughly serviced daily. A no smoking policy is in force.
Leeford is close to many, many interesting and beautiful places to visit including Lynton and Lynmouth (England's "Little Switzerland"). There is walking, angling and horseriding on the doorstep and if you are an artist, photographer or bird-watcher you'll not have enough hours in the day! The famous resorts of Minehead, Barnstaple and Ilfracombe are in easy reach and the fabulous beaches of Croyde and Woolacombe are under an hour away. Leeford has a lovely garden, orchard and paddock, if you just want to relax and enjoy the ambience of the quiet countryside.

Location & area
Set in the Lyn Valley on the coastal edge of Exmoor National Park. The park is in the beautiful and unspoilt South West corner of England in the county of Devon

Important Notice : Avoiding Fraud
It's rare, but some helpful hints to watch out for with regards to fraud:
- It is important to NEVER wire funds or use/employ other fund transfer mechanisms such as western union: Always use a credit card to protect yourself against fraud. If owners pressure you into providing a deposit or refuse to accept credit cards, there is a high probability that this is a scam.
- If at all suspicious of fraud, ask to see their website, or any other literature they can provide or send to you. Ask them for contact details for guests who have previously stayed on their property insisting on telephone numbers. Be suspicious of emails that originate from free email services (yahoo, hotmail, gmail, etc)
- Research the property thoroughly on the internet to see if there is any history or mention of scams associated with the property.
